Correspondence regarding groups of Russians represented by the "Union des Zemstvos Russes pour le Royaume des Serbes, Croates et Slovènes" for placement in France as Agricultural Workers. Includes information ("renseignements") provided by representatives of the Cossacks in the Kingdom of S.C.S (Koban, Don and Terek Cossacks). The exchanges between the Geneva Office and Zemstvos Union president is subsequently taken over by the Belgrade Office (Mr. Childs).
Correspondence between the Union (G. Chpilevoy, President), on behalf of a Group of Cossacks (agricultural workers), and the Geneva Office (via ILO Director, Albert Thomas) regarding assistance for settlement of 170 families in Uruguay. Also includes letters from "Union des agriculteurs de la Russie Méridionale", Belgrade, exchanged with the Near East delegate, Mr. Childs.
